Decreased cold‐sensing function of the transient receptor potential channel TRPM8 from tailed amphibians

open access: yesFEBS Open Bio, EarlyView.
Despite frogs avoiding low temperatures, examination of four salamander species revealed that none avoided cold and all possessed cold tolerance. Functional analysis of TRPM8, a cold sensor, showed that all salamander TRPM8s had lost their cold sensitivity.

Influence of Sample Preparation and Processing Procedures on the Thermal Diffusivity of MgO‐C Refractories

open access: yesAdvanced Engineering Materials, EarlyView.
The thermal diffusivity of MgO‐C refractories is highly sensitive to sample preparation and processing procedures. In this article, the effects of coking sequence, machining conditions, structural inhomogeneity, and graphite coating application on measurements using laser flash apparatus are systematically investigated.

Powder Optimization Strategies for Binder Jetting Printing of BaTiO3 and Ba0,6Sr0,4TiO3 Ceramics

open access: yesAdvanced Engineering Materials, EarlyView.
Powder optimization is investigated to enable binder jetting of BaTiO3 and Ba0.6Sr0.4TiO3 ferroelectric ceramics. The antagonistic relationship between flowability and binder compatibility is addressed through binder impregnation of granulated powders and fumed silica addition to fine powders.
